We are building the future of decentralized, intelligent aerial networks — combining cutting-edge biology, machine learning, and drone technologies. As a Mechatronics Integration Engineer, you'll be at the heart of our hardware development efforts, helping us design, manufacture, and integrate mechanical components for bio-inspired surveillance drones. You'll work closely with engineers across multiple disciplines to prototype, test, and iterate on drone systems that operate autonomously and at scale. This is a hands-on role for someone who th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ative, and startup environment and enjoys taking ideas from concept to reality using CAD tools, mechanical fabrication, and precise documentation.
